Pioneer Urbanites: A Social and Cultural History of Black San Francisco Douglas Henry Daniels
Pioneer Urbanites: A Social and Cultural History of Black San Francisco
Douglas Henry Daniels
The black migration to San Francisco and the Bay Area differed from the mass movement of Southern rural blacks and their families into the eastern industrial cities. This title provides the picture of the lives of black San Franciscans from the 1860s to the 1940s.
